3:30 P.M. MONDAY UPDATE: Because of increased sales across the country, the projected jackpot has been raised to $191 million.

10:05 A.M. MONDAY UPDATE: Nobody has come forward yet to claim the prize, said store manager Barbara Martinez, noting the winner can also claim the prize by going to the state office or other offices.

Somebody won Friday's $188-million Mega Millions jackpot prize with a ticket purchased at Primm Valley Lotto.

The winning numbers were 17, 37, 53, 54, 61 and the Mega Ball of 8.

The winner has not yet come forward.

"It is the largest Mega Millions jackpot ticket the store has ever sold," said Barbara Martinez, a supervisor at the lotto store. "People sure are talking about it."

In a news release late Saturday morning, the California Lottery said the winner will have the option of taking the full $188 million spread out over 30 years, or a lump sum amount of $112.3 million (less federal taxes).

"We will not know who the winner is until the ticket is claimed. We strongly encourage last night's winner to immediately sign the back of your ticket in ink and keep it in a safe place until they can get to one of the nine California Lottery District Office Locations. The winner has one year from the date of the draw to claim their prize."

The store will receive a bonus of up to 0.5 percent of the prize from the California State Lottery.
